Man as Being-at-Play (Homo ludens)
Authors:
Bishop David
Perovic
Pages: -
Abstract:
The practice is constantly informing us about how a man cannot do anything without entering his eros and ethos of the game. That is why everything is so important. That is why everything is so unpredictable. Events imbued with Eros of game takes the game itself to upper level of the events, events of life and death. So in life you live the way the game and the price is life or death. That is why the Fool child is a living, and a life governed child, who plays for a life, and breakaway from the game child-clown, is the most cynical killer, who plays for the death.
